giantappleEven DIY PC die-hards can appreciate the svelte lines of Apple’s wafer theeeen wireless and USB keyboards. Hackers apparently like them too.

Digital Society is reporting a guy called “K. Chen” found a way to hack the Mac keyboard with a nefarious firmware update that can key log and potentially execute a keyboard command through the console to really open up systems to a digital assault. According to reports, it only takes 18 seconds and because it’s a keyboard firmware hack, reformatting won’t fix the problem. Check out the video here.

Thankfully K. Chen is working with Apple engineers to fix the exploit saving every Apple store in the nation from being unwilling participants in what would otherwise be a nice botnet.
